The ECU is the brain of the vehicle’s engine, responsible for controlling various engine functions such as fuel injection, ignition timing, and emissions. Over time, the ECU can become faulty or corrupted, leading to various problems. In some cases, disconnecting the battery may not be feasible or may cause other issues. Therefore, resetting the ECU without disconnecting the battery is a viable solution.
